Chojnik Castle is a historic fortress located on a hilltop, offering panoramic views of the surrounding landscape and a glimpse into medieval architecture.
The Rynek Jeleniogórski is the charming main square of Jelenia Góra, featuring colorful historic buildings, cafes, and a lively atmosphere.

Podgórna Waterfall is a picturesque waterfall located in the Karkonosze Mountains, perfect for nature lovers and photographers.
Park Norweski is a beautiful green space in Jelenia Góra, ideal for a relaxing walk or a picnic amidst nature.
The Muzeum Przyrodnicze in Cieplice offers exhibits on the natural history of the region, including local flora and fauna.
Muzeum Karkonoskie showcases the rich cultural and artistic heritage of the Karkonosze region, with a variety of exhibits and artifacts.
The Municipal Museum of Gerhart Hauptmann's House is dedicated to the life and work of the Nobel Prize-winning writer, offering insights into his legacy.
Wojanowska Tower and Gate are remnants of the medieval city walls, offering a glimpse into the historical defenses of Jelenia Góra.
Park Paulinum is a serene park in Jelenia Góra, perfect for leisurely strolls and enjoying the natural beauty of the area.
Borowy Jar Punkt Widokowy offers stunning views of the surrounding landscape, making it a great spot for photography and relaxation.
Tężnia Cieplice is a unique saline graduation tower, offering a healthful experience with its therapeutic microclimate.
The Karkonosze National Park Education Centre in Sobieszów Palace provides educational exhibits and information about the park's natural environment.
Czarny Kocioł Jagniątkowski is a glacial cirque in the Karkonosze Mountains, known for its stunning natural beauty and hiking opportunities.
Schaffgotsch's Palace is a historic building in Cieplice, showcasing impressive architecture and the history of the Schaffgotsch family.
